2018: Played in all 13 games…Recorded 27 tackles with 11 solo stops…Had 1.5 tackles for a loss of four yards…Posted one interception, one pass breakup and two quarterback hurries…Registered a season-high seven tackles at Tennessee Tech (10/6)…Had his first career interception at Murray State (11/10)…Also turned in three tackles at Southern Illinois (9/15) and vs. Eastern Illinois (11/17).
2017: Played in 11 games, mainly on special teams...Recorded four tackles...Had two tackles at Jacksonville State (10/28).
2016: Played in nine games, primarily on special teams...Won the team’s Defensive Work MVP award...Tallied four tackles and two solo stops...Returned five kickoffs for 30 yards...Had a 21-yard kick return at Eastern Kentucky (10/8).
Prep: Named the SEMOBall Awards Male Athlete of the Year and Boys Track & Field Athlete of the Year...Four-year starter at Malden High School, who played with his brother, Kylus...Led the Green Wave in rushing and was the team’s top defender at linebacker...Named the 2015 Standard Democrat Football Defensive Player of the Year...Anchored a defense that allowed 21 points a game and reached the Class 2 State Championship game...Malden took second against Lamar... Recorded 124 tackles, 26 tackles for loss, one sack, two fumble recoveries and nine pass breakups as a senior...Was fourth in the SEMO Conference in total tackles...Ran for 1,462 yards and 28 touchdowns...Was selected to both the coaches and media Class 2 All-State teams as a member of the first team...Won state titles in the shot put and discus.
Personal: Born November 10, 1997...Majoring in General Studies...Son of Shuneka Minniefield and Dajuan Thompson.
